Mistral AI founder to French Parliament: "Engineers at Mistral no longer write a single line of code
Summary
Mistral AI's founder told the French Parliament that engineers at the company no longer write code themselves, instead supervising AI agents that generate code, describing a shift from craftsman to manager with productivity gains of 10x-20x for solo work but bottlenecks in teams.
